Output 654164806f7fba809f023f4fe977aa5cec5ba9a23b1bed28344586eaa82825f0:30

value
340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f521d8c55cad0933cb80b239601f435261931b7 OP_EQUAL
address
361E43Eh3sScgnBVRNJCoQx6y7UVYfcxSF
transaction
654164806f7fba809f023f4fe977aa5cec5ba9a23b1bed28344586eaa82825f0
confirmations
260982
spent
true